There are three main components in a planetary gearbox: sunlight gear, the earth gears and the ring gear. The gears are attached to the planet carrier that has teeth on the inside, which is the ring gear.
Planetary Reducer & Gearmotor
Planetary Gearbox – DieQua Corporation
Planetary gearboxes are able to produce many different reduction ratios because of the different world gears that revolve around the sun gear. Planetary gearboxes are constructed of heavy duty steel such as steel and are in a position to handle huge shock loads well. Nevertheless, different planetary gearboxes are created for specific quickness, load and torque capacities. The predominant use for planetary gearboxes is certainly in motor vehicles with automatic transmissions. Unlike manual transmission, in which the operator is responsible for switching gears, automobiles that have automatic transmissions use clutches, brake bands and planetary gearboxes to improve the inputs and outputs, therefore adjusting the speeds appropriately.
An automatic transmitting contains two complete planetary gearsets positioned together into one element. Planetary gearboxes are also used in electric screwdrivers, sprinklers and applications that want huge or multiple reductions from a concise mechanism. Planetary gearboxes are one of many variations of acceleration reducers in fact it is essential that the proper mechanism is used. Gearboxes may even be combined to create the desired outcomes and the most common kinds are helical equipment reducers, worm gear reducers and inline equipment reducers.
Planetary gearboxes gain their advantages through their design. The sun gear’s central position allows the planet gears to rotate in the same path and for the ring gear (the edge of the planet carrier) to turn the same manner as the sun gear. In a few arrangements the sun gear can simultaneously turn all the planets because they also engage the band gear. Any of the three components could be the insight, the output or held stationary, which results in lots of different reduction ratio opportunities.
In lots of planetary gearboxes one element is held stationary with another component serving as the input and the other as output. The reduction ratios for planetary gearboxes are influenced by the number of teeth in the gears and what components are involved. Generally, the load ability and torque boosts with the number of planets in the system because the load is certainly distributed among the gears and there is definitely low energy waste materials; planetary gearboxes are highly efficient, averaging between 96 and 98%. The look is complex, nevertheless, and difficult to access for repairs or maintenance.
Axial or Inline gearboxes make reference to such types as Helical, Shaft mounted, or planetary designs.
These gearboxes are very common choices for most industrial applications because of their robust nature, high permissible radial forces, closely stepped ratios and low backlash.
Helical gearboxes can typically be found in applications requiring high permissible radial force, stepped ratios and low backlash.
Shaft-mounted or otherwise known as Parallel shaft gearboxes provide an inline option with a versatile and space saving foot print. This is the only inline gearbox edition with the option of a hollow result shaft.
Planetary gearboxes are often chosen for high tech, high torque, high speed applications requiring extreme accuracy.
